milk churning
Technical term for the process of agitating milk or cream to make butter.
Butter is made by churning milk.
Standard kanji spelling for 'milk churning'.
Variant kanji form using 攪 instead of 撹; both are used.
Compound of 撹 (かく, 'stir, agitate') and 乳 (にゅう, 'milk'). The exact historical derivation is uncertain, but the term is a straightforward technical compound.
